PYPL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

1,782 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PayPal (PYPL)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$47.2B — down 13% from $54.1B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 188 funds closed out of PYPL and 128 opened new positions — a net loss of 60 holders — while 772 trimmed existing stakes and 623 added.

The largest buyer was Goldman Sachs, adding an estimated $239M. The largest seller was UBS AM, cutting an estimated $156M.
